### v4.8.0 — Changed defaults

Resolved the long-standing N+1 query pattern in the Quillbranch GraphQL layer. Nested `orderLines` resolvers now batch through the dataloader by default instead of issuing one query per parent. This changes latency characteristics: expect fewer, larger database round trips. Contractors upgrading older deployments must verify batching is not disabled by legacy overrides. The new default resolver settings shipped with this release are listed below.

deployment values, bagag-bawig:
DRUVAN_PIN=0740
DRUVAN_TENANT=wendor
DRUVAN_METRICS_HOST=metrics.druvan.tolvaqnet.example
DRUVAN_SEAL=seal_75cd0b2d
DRUVAN_STANDBY_TEAM=tamael

TICKET SPOOL-1193: PrintRelay microservice — recurring connection failures

Since the Oxveil datacenter failover on the 14th, the PrintRelay spooler service has been losing its database connection roughly every six hours. Job-queue writes fail with pool timeout errors, and queued print jobs stall until the pod restarts. We believe the keepalive interval is shorter than the new load balancer's idle cutoff. For future maintainers: reproduce by idling a connection past ten minutes against the queue database, reachable via the string below.

replica DSN, yahaf-yagaf: mongodb://tamath_svc:a2netSk3RZMuTj@db-d084.novacsoft.internal:5432/ralmir

## Service Accounts — Formula Sandbox

Quick notes for eng sync. User-supplied formulas in Gridlet now execute inside the Hatchbox sandbox under the `formula-runner` service account. No filesystem, no outbound network except the evaluator service. Account is scoped to evaluate-only. To run the sandbox locally against staging, authenticate with the key below.

gateway credential: qvz7-vWy80ME